Outdoor Adventures in Rancho Cucamonga
For nature lovers, Rancho Cucamonga boasts a plethora of outdoor activities. From scenic parks to breathtaking hiking trails, there’s no shortage of ways to explore the great outdoors. Some highlights include:
- Pacific Electric Inland Empire Trail: Embark on a 21-mile journey of scenic countryside, perfect for hiking, biking, or horseback riding.
- Sapphire Falls: Trek through Cucamonga Canyon to discover the stunning blue waters and foaming waterfalls of Sapphire Falls.
- Etiwanda Falls: Enjoy a picturesque hike at the North Etiwanda Preserve, known for its panoramic views and tranquil surroundings.

Enjoy Entertainment and Nightlife
When the sun sets, Rancho Cucamonga comes alive with a variety of entertainment options. From live music venues to sports events, there’s something for everyone. Don’t miss these highlights:
- Rancho Cucamonga Quakes: Catch a minor league baseball game at LoanMart Field and enjoy classic ballpark snacks while cheering on the team.
- Lewis Family Playhouse: Immerse yourself in the arts scene at this state-of-the-art theater, showcasing a diverse range of performances for all audiences.
